### Runbook: Account recovery — Squeezeframe telemetry compressor

Hey plugin authors — if your Squeezeframe publishing account locks up (usually from too many failed payload-signing attempts), compressed telemetry will buffer locally, so nothing's lost. Head to the Duskport developer portal, choose "Recover plugin account," and verify your plugin slug. The portal then asks for the shared recovery passphrase before it re-enables uploads. For registered authors, that passphrase is:

strongbox words: gilok-druion-briath-wendor-briion-prawyn-fenion-oliir-casdor-holius-briius-gilath-gilael-pelys

## Fan-out backpressure

NotifyGrid fans out events to channel workers. If the queue depth on Pulsewick exceeds 50k, backpressure kicks in and producers get 429s. Don't raise the cap; drain with the skim worker instead. Dashboards live under the "fanout" folder. The skim worker authenticates to the internal throttle service with the key below.

app token of bawep-hafog = kto7_vwrmnlx

# Session Handling — Splitline Assignment Service

For eng sync: Splitline assigns A/B buckets per session, not per user. Sessions are keyed server-side; the client holds only an opaque session ID. Bucket assignment is sticky for the session lifetime (24h TTL, sliding). Re-assignment only occurs on explicit experiment restart. All assignment API calls require bearer auth; tokens rotate weekly via authsvc. Known issue: expired sessions briefly return stale buckets (fix in flight). For manual verification against staging, use the token below.

bearer token for bahip-tajeg: eyJhbGciOiJIUzI1NiIsInR5cCI6IkpXVCJ9.eyJzdWIiOiI1L7f3gIn0.wcG2mhGD

### Canteen Access — Visiting Contractors

The Larchgate canteen on Level 1 is shared with our neighbours at Ferrow Analytics under a joint catering agreement. Contractors may use it between 11:30 and 14:00, but please note that the connecting corridor beyond the servery belongs to Ferrow and is out of bounds. Payment is card only. To enter the canteen from the contractor wing, key in the door code below:

badge for hahip-bagag: bdg-FIJ-9